October 22nd, 2018 at 7:03 PM ^
Maybe, but I have a hard time buying it. With Singleton it makes sense. Ross and Gil as presumed starters, already behind Anthony it seems, McGrone a year younger but big recruiting profile and supposed to be Bush 2.0. That puts him 5th at a spot that plays 2, with 3 of the guys above him his year or younger. That makes sense to transfer out because of competition.
RT comes open next year with the second tackle spot the year after. Obviously offseason hype isn't everything, but he and Mayfield got the most hype out of young OL. We didn't hear much about Honigford or Stueber, and Hayes is a true freshman who probably needs 2 years just to get to a passable playing size (listed as a 6'7 271 TE on the roster, was 262 out of HS). I also don't think Hudson or the coaches have him behind incoming freshmen who are still in HS and aren't instant impact players.
The optimistic view is he was already behind Mayfield at LT and Stueber passed him at RT, hence Stueber coming off the bench after JBB on Saturday, and that caused the transfer. But that's ignoring the idea that Hudson was ahead of Stueber and transferred out for other reasons, or that he could have re-passed him over the spring/fall next year. Regardless, with him and Hall gone from last year's class, we're now down to 4 playable tackles for next year and that hurts depth.
Whether he transferred for personal or PT reasons, I won't fault him. He has to do what's best for him. I still think we'll be fine at tackle next year. But this hurts depth and limits our potential options in case someone doesn't pan out or gets injured. This isn't LB where depth is highly touted and high in numbers so I'm skeptical that he's already leaving because of depth chart issues. Unless he's fallen well behind Stueber/Mayfield, which is possible, but I don't really know if we have a reason to believe that beyond blind optimism.
